Reasonable accommodation is any modification or adjustment to a job or the work environment that will enable an applicant or employee with a disability to participate in the application process or to perform essential job functions. WebEssential job functions are the fundamental responsibilities of a job that must be completed to hold the position. For example, an essential job function for a truck driver is the ability to drive trucks. This criteria is used to determine whether an employer has discriminated against an employee under the Americans with Disabilities Act.

WebOct 7, 2003 · The ADA applies to private employers with 15 or more employees and to state and local government employers. The U.S.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) enforces the employment provisions of the ADA. WebJun 11, 2024 · The main reason that the inclusion of essential and non-essential job functions in job descriptions is important is that it protects employers against claims of discrimination. Under the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A), any employee that can perform the essential functions of the job is protected from discrimination by the employer.
